March 30, 1981: UNC loses 63-50 to Indiana in the national title game the day Ronald Reagan was shot. Al Wood had 18 points in his final game for North Carolina. UNC's players were tired of hearing how Dean Smith couldn't win the big one, so they vowed the day after the title game that they'd make sure to rectify that the next year - and they did.
